Lahore: Pakistan pace bowler Wahab Riaz has challenged Test skipper Azhar Ali to do some squats after Azhar posted a video of doing pushups with his sons.
The 34-year-old pacer wants Azhar to do 50 squats in total. “To Azhar Ali, we’ve all seen you do push-ups, but now I challenge you to do some squats! 50 to do in total and make sure they’re done properly, let’s go! And please mention who you challenge next!” Wahab wrote on Twitter.

Azhar, on the other hand, has accepted and will soon complete the challenge.

Pakistan cricketers are making sure to use this break by performing healthy activities and want everyone to take part in it.
It must be noted here that the entire world is suffering through coronavirus. Several countries have locked down their cities completely to avoid further spread of this disease. Popular sports events around the world have also been postponed for an indefinite period
